The process involves analyzing a user’s perceived needs and priorities during a phone call to intelligently suggest a relevant application. This selection mechanism leverages the contextual information derived from the conversation to anticipate user intent and provide timely assistance. For example, if a user mentions needing to schedule a meeting during a phone call, the system might suggest opening a calendar application.
This functionality enhances user experience by streamlining task completion and minimizing the need for manual app searches.
